         <description><![CDATA[<div> If all the alveoli in both lungs were flattened out, they would have a total area of about 160 square meters—about 80% of the size of a singles tennis court and about 80 times greater than the surface area of an average-sized adult’s skin.<br><br></div><div><br></div>]]></description>
